Building accounting professionals manage financials on projects and for their business overall. Tasks include: planning/coordinating job financials looking after numerous kinds of economic analysis (i.e. project price estimates) evaluating monetary records (i.e. invoices, contracts, etc) tracking expenses and revenue assessing (and identifying means to address) monetary risks, both on private tasks and those influencing the business all at once preparing and submitting economic records, both to stakeholders and relevant regulative bodies To become a building and construction accounting professional, a specific have to typically have a bachelor's degree in an accounting-related field.

A building accounting professional prepares financial declarations, keeps an eye on expenses and spending plans, and functions with job supervisors and affiliates to make sure that the companys financial needs are fulfilled. A building accountant functions as part of the audit division, which is in charge of creating monetary records and analyses. Building and construction accounting professionals might likewise assist with payroll, which is a kind of accounting.

$1m $5m in yearly profits A controller is normally in charge of the bookkeeping department. A controller might set up the accountancy division (construction bookkeeping).
The construction check my source controller supervises of developing precise job-cost bookkeeping records, getting involved in audits and preparing records for regulatory authorities. Furthermore, the controller is accountable for guaranteeing your business adhere to economic coverage rules and regulations. They're additionally required for budgeting and tracking annual efficiency in connection with the yearly budget.
